<description>&#60;p&#62;@brady80: Just got back from doing this last week :) First recommendation is try to catch a direct flight from wherever you are, it'll make the trips down and back way less painful. Also yes, if you can cook your own meals in the condo, that'll help with not scheduling 3 meals/day out around naps and bedtime... that single thing alone made our lives a ton easier. Also having a pool right on site so we could jump out with LO for a quick swim, or one of us could go out while LO was napping and someone stayed back to man the monitor. Where are you coming from?
